AMORY, Miss. (WTVA) -- A Smithville teenager faces charges after authorities found cocaine during a traffic stop Tuesday night.

The Monroe County Sheriff's Department reports Raheem Jabarr Warren, 18, was stopped by officers on Cotton Gin Port Road.

Officials say they discovered crack cocaine and powder cocaine during a pat down.

Warren was a passenger in the vehicle.

He was charged with two counts of possession.                                                                               

Amory Police and the North Mississippi Narcotics Unit assisted with the arrest.
